Nile River, Southern Egypt
The Nile is a major north-flowing river in northeastern Africa, generally regarded as the longest river in the world. It is a major transportation channel and water source for irrigation for Egypt.
Read More35 / 43
Small boats along the Nile River in Egypt.
Copyright T. Klassen Photography